Choice
What is a choice?
The act of choosing between two or more possibilities.
Making a decision while considering consequences
Slide 7 - Tekstslide
Responsibility
Something or a standard that is expected of someone.
E.g. guards arresting criminals for the safety of others

Consequence
The outcome of an action/choice, which can be either good or bad.
Bad- Staying up late:
- Falling asleep in class
Good- Putting extra effort into your study:
- Getting a high grade

Further Definitions
Dignity (in choice making)
- the sense of self-worth and respect each person should have
Respect (for responsibility)
- to have proper regard for the feelings and rights of other people
When we respect a thing or idea, we consider it important and take care of it
Concern (for consequence)-
to be worried about or have an interest in someone or something
Slide 14 - Tekstslide
Personal Beliefs & Values
Each of the keywords we just covered relates to peoples individual beliefs and values
The choices that people make often related to what they believe in
Individual beliefs and values stem from Morality
